Job Description
We are seeking a dedicated and skilled Pipeline Engineer to join our dynamic team in Holbeck, Leeds. This role offers an exciting opportunity to contribute to critical infrastructure projects, working on the design, analysis, and implementation of various pipeline systems. You will be instrumental in ensuring the safety, efficiency, and sustainability of our projects, collaborating with multi-disciplinary teams and utilising cutting-edge engineering principles.
Key Responsibilities
- Perform detailed design and analysis of pipelines for various applications, including water, wastewater, oil, and gas.
- Develop specifications, calculations, and drawings in accordance with relevant industry standards and codes.
- Conduct feasibility studies, risk assessments, and optioneering to determine optimal pipeline routes and designs.
- Collaborate with project managers, clients, and other engineering disciplines to ensure integrated project delivery.
- Prepare technical reports, presentations, and documentation for internal and external stakeholders.
- Participate in site visits, inspections, and construction support activities as required.
- Ensure compliance with health, safety, and environmental regulations throughout the project lifecycle.
- Mentor junior engineers and contribute to knowledge sharing within the team.
Required Skills
- Bachelor's degree in Civil, Mechanical, or Pipeline Engineering.
- Minimum of 3 years of experience in pipeline design and engineering.
- Proficiency in pipeline design software (e.g., Caesar II, AutoPIPE, WaterCAD, SewerCAD).
- Strong understanding of relevant industry codes and standards (e.g., API, ASME, EN, DNV).
-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Effective communication and teamwork abilities.
- Demonstrated ability to manage multiple tasks and meet deadlines.
- Valid UK driving license.
Preferred Qualifications
- Master's degree in a relevant engineering discipline.
- Chartered Engineer status or actively working towards it.
- Experience with GIS applications for pipeline routing and analysis.
- Knowledge of trenchless technology methods.
- Experience in hydraulic modelling and surge analysis.
